Output ae16a7317d1314b64a528036342b7a3d2eebf7097b3cbfa78ed4666ae3e603e0:0

value
608992121
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45fca1f1661e7ddff1b96f50dadbf87450f4e1b2 OP_EQUALVERIFY OP_CHECKSIG
address
17P4GTUCNCm4r6Pb2HXnniiL3f9R1gdx4Q
transaction
ae16a7317d1314b64a528036342b7a3d2eebf7097b3cbfa78ed4666ae3e603e0
confirmations
699991
spent
true